Match Overview
The australia women’s national cricket team vs india women’s national cricket team match scorecard for the Only Test of the India Women tour of Australia 2025-26 showcases a dominant Australian performance at the iconic W.A.C.A. Ground in Perth. Played from March 6-8, 2026, this day-night Test match was the pinnacle of a multi-format series that included T20Is and ODIs
Australia Women won the toss and elected to bowl first, a decision that paid rich dividends. After India posted 198 in their first innings, Australia responded with a commanding 323, taking a crucial 125-run lead. India’s second innings collapse to 149 set up a straightforward target of just 25 runs, which Australia chased down without losing a wicket in just 4.3 overs. The final result: Australia Women won by 10 wickets. All-rounder Annabel Sutherland was named Player of the Match for her exceptional all-round performance, scoring 129 runs in the first innings and claiming 4 wickets

Key Highlights & Match Analysis
The australia women’s national cricket team vs india women’s national cricket team match scorecard tells the story of a comprehensive Australian victory built on superior batting depth and disciplined bowling.
Top Batting Performance: Annabel Sutherland’s magnificent 129 off 171 balls was the cornerstone of Australia’s first-innings total. Her innings featured 17 boundaries and showcased remarkable composure under pressure, forming a crucial 128-run partnership with Ellyse Perry (76) that shifted the momentum decisively in Australia’s favor
For India, Jemimah Rodrigues’ gritty 52 in the first innings and Pratika Rawal’s resilient 63 in the second were the standout contributions, but they lacked sufficient support from the rest of the batting lineup.
Top Bowling Performance: Sayali Satghare was India’s most impressive bowler, claiming 4 wickets for 50 runs in 18.4 overs in Australia’s first innings, consistently troubling the Australian batters with her accuracy. However, Australia’s bowling attack was more balanced. Annabel Sutherland picked up 4 wickets in India’s first innings, while Lucy Hamilton’s 3-wicket haul in the second innings helped dismantle India’s lower order at a critical juncture.
Turning Point of the Match: The pivotal moment came during Australia’s first innings when Sutherland and Perry added 128 runs for the fourth wicket. India had reduced Australia to 58/3, but this partnership not only rescued the innings but also gave Australia a commanding 125-run lead. This buffer proved insurmountable for India, who then collapsed to 149 in their second innings.
Records & Milestones: This match saw several notable achievements. Ellyse Perry became the highest run-scorer in Test cricket for Australia, surpassing Karen Rolton, and also reached 1,000 Test runs during her innings
For India, this match marked the Test debuts of five players: Lucy Hamilton (Australia), and Kranti Gaud, Kashvee Gautam, Pratika Rawal, and Sayali Satghare (India). Additionally, this was the final international match for Australian captain Alyssa Healy, who announced her retirement from cricket after the series .
